如何加载微信热力图

奔跑的蜗牛 热力图 0

回复

共4条回复 我来回复
  • 已被采纳为最佳回答

    加载微信热力图的步骤包括:了解热力图的概念、获取所需数据、使用微信开发者工具进行调试、编写代码实现热力图加载、发布并测试效果。 热力图是一种数据可视化工具,能够通过颜色深浅表示数据的分布情况。在微信小程序中,热力图常用于展示用户行为、地理位置或其他相关数据。在实现热力图加载之前,开发者需要确保拥有相关的数据集,这些数据集可以是用户的地理位置信息、交互频率或其他相关指标。根据这些数据,开发者可以使用微信提供的API接口,利用Canvas或其他绘图库来实现热力图的绘制效果。通过合理的设计和精确的数据处理,热力图能够为用户提供直观的数据分析体验。

    一、热力图的概念及应用

    热力图是数据可视化的一种形式,通过不同的颜色来表现数据的强度和分布情况,通常用于展示地理信息、用户行为等。在微信小程序中,热力图的应用场景广泛,比如用户活动热度分析、位置分布展示等。这种可视化方式能够帮助开发者和用户更直观地理解数据,进而做出更有效的决策。热力图不仅可以展示数据的密集程度,还能通过色彩变化反映出数据的变化趋势。比如,在用户行为分析中,热力图可以帮助开发者识别出用户活跃的区域,从而优化产品设计和推广策略。

    二、获取所需数据

    在加载微信热力图之前,开发者需要收集相关的数据。这些数据通常包括用户的地理位置信息、行为记录等。获取这些数据的方式有很多,例如通过用户的授权获取位置信息、从数据库中提取用户行为数据等。确保数据的准确性和完整性是非常重要的,这样才能生成有效的热力图。数据通常以坐标点的形式存在,开发者需要将这些坐标点整理成适合热力图展示的格式。在数据处理过程中,可以使用数据清洗和标准化的方法,确保数据的质量和一致性。对于位置数据,开发者还需要考虑数据的隐私保护,确保在数据使用时遵循相关的法律法规。

    三、使用微信开发者工具进行调试

    在实现热力图加载之前,开发者需要使用微信开发者工具进行调试。微信开发者工具是一个功能强大的调试环境,能够帮助开发者实时查看和调整代码。在这个环境中,开发者可以模拟不同的设备和操作系统,检查热力图的显示效果。在加载热力图之前,开发者需要先创建一个小程序项目,并在项目中引入相关的热力图绘制库。可以选择一些开源的热力图库,例如heatmap.js,来简化开发过程。在调试过程中,开发者需要关注热力图的加载速度、响应时间和用户交互效果,确保热力图能够在各种设备上流畅运行。

    四、编写代码实现热力图加载

    加载微信热力图的核心在于编写代码实现数据的可视化。首先,开发者需要在小程序的页面中引入热力图的绘制库,并在相应的生命周期函数中初始化热力图。可以使用Canvas绘制热力图,Canvas是一种强大的绘图工具,能够实现多种复杂的绘图效果。在热力图的绘制过程中,开发者需要将获取到的坐标点数据传入热力图库中,并设置热力图的样式参数,如半径、颜色范围等。设置参数时,需要根据数据的特性进行调整,以确保热力图能够准确反映数据的分布情况。完成代码编写后,开发者可以在微信开发者工具中进行预览和调试,确保热力图的效果符合预期。

    五、发布并测试效果

    完成热力图的加载和调试后,开发者需要将小程序发布到微信平台。在发布之前,可以邀请一些用户进行内测,收集他们的反馈意见,进一步优化热力图的表现。在小程序上线后,开发者应持续关注热力图的使用情况,收集用户的使用数据和反馈,以便进行后续的改进。定期更新热力图的数据源和展示效果,能够保持小程序的活跃度和用户粘性。此外,开发者还可以根据用户行为数据对热力图进行个性化调整,让用户体验更加友好。通过不断优化热力图的功能和展示效果,能够为用户提供更好的数据分析体验,提升小程序的整体价值。

    六、总结

    加载微信热力图是一个综合性的过程,涉及到数据的获取、处理和可视化展示。开发者需要对热力图的概念有深刻的理解,掌握数据的收集和处理技术,同时熟悉微信开发者工具的使用。通过合理的代码编写和细致的调试,可以实现高质量的热力图效果,为用户提供直观的数据分析体验。在未来,随着用户需求的不断变化,热力图的应用场景将会更加广泛,开发者需要不断提升自己的技术水平,以适应市场的变化。

    1天前 0条评论
  • 小飞棍来咯的头像
    小飞棍来咯
    这个人很懒,什么都没有留下~
    评论

    加载微信热力图是一项非常有用的功能,可以帮助用户更好地了解微信用户行为、地理位置分布和热门区域情况。以下是加载微信热力图的几种方法:

    1. 使用微信小程序:
      在微信小程序中,可以通过调用微信JSSDK中的地图相关API来加载微信热力图。首先需要在小程序中引入地图组件,然后使用JSSDK提供的接口获取微信用户的地理位置信息,再根据用户位置数据生成热力图展示在地图上。这样用户就可以通过小程序来查看微信热力图数据。

    2. 使用高德地图API:
      高德地图API提供了丰富的地图展示功能,包括热力图功能。用户可以在自己的网页或应用中使用高德地图API加载微信热力图数据,展示微信用户活跃度、地理位置分布等信息。通过高德地图API可以实现更加灵活的地图展示和数据可视化。

    3. 使用百度地图API:
      百度地图API也提供了强大的地图展示功能,包括热力图功能。用户可以在自己的网页或应用中使用百度地图API加载微信热力图数据,展示微信用户活跃度、地理位置分布等信息。百度地图API提供了丰富的SDK和开发文档,方便开发者快速集成地图功能。

    4. 使用Google Maps API:
      Google Maps API是一套功能强大的地图服务,也支持加载热力图功能。用户可以在自己的网页或应用中使用Google Maps API加载微信热力图数据,展示微信用户活跃度、地理位置分布等信息。Google Maps API提供了丰富的地图展示效果和交互功能,可以让用户更加直观地查看微信热力图数据。

    5. 自定义开发:
      除了以上几种方法外,用户还可以自行开发加载微信热力图的功能。通过调用地图API和数据可视化库,用户可以按照自己的需求和设计来展示微信用户的热力图数据。这种方式可以实现更加个性化和定制化的地图展示效果,满足用户自定义的需求。

    3个月前 0条评论
  • 要加载微信热力图,通常需要使用微信开发者工具和相关的前端技术。下面将详细介绍如何实现加载微信热力图的步骤:

    1. 准备工作:首先,需要拥有一个微信公众号,并获取到对应的AppID。然后,下载微信开发者工具并登录,这样可以在开发者工具中进行调试和预览。

    2. 获取地理位置信息:要显示热力图,需要获取用户的地理位置信息。可以通过微信小程序API提供的wx.getLocation接口获取用户的地理位置坐标。

    3. 引入热力图库:在小程序的json配置文件中引入需要使用的热力图库,常用的是heatmap.js或者leaflet-heatmap等库。可以通过npm安装或者直接引入CDN链接。

    4. 绘制热力图:在页面的js文件中使用引入的热力图库,根据用户的地理位置信息生成热力图数据,并绘制在地图上。可以通过调用热力图库提供的API进行热力图的设置和绘制。

    5. 显示热力图:最后,在页面的wxml文件中添加一个地图组件,并在js文件中将生成的热力图数据和配置传递给地图组件,以显示热力图。

    总的来说,加载微信热力图需要先获取用户地理位置信息,然后引入热力图库,绘制热力图数据,并最终在页面上显示出来。通过以上步骤,就可以在微信小程序中加载并显示热力图了。

    3个月前 0条评论
  • 如何加载微信热力图

    微信热力图是一种通过地理信息展示用户分布密度的可视化方式,通常用于分析用户集中区域、人流量热度等信息。在微信小程序开发中,加载微信热力图可以帮助开发者更直观地了解用户的行为习惯,从而优化产品功能或营销策略。下面将介绍如何加载微信热力图。

    步骤一:准备数据

    首先,需要准备包含地理信息的数据,例如用户位置坐标。通常这些数据可以通过用户授权位置信息获取或者其他方式收集。确保数据格式正确并包含经纬度等必要信息。

    步骤二:引入第三方库

    加载微信热力图需要使用第三方库来实现,例如heatmap.js。在小程序开发中,可以使用小程序官方对canvas的封装进行绘制。首先需要在小程序中引入相关的第三方库,可以通过npm安装或直接引入CDN链接的方式导入。

    步骤三:绘制热力图

    接下来,需要在小程序页面中创建一个canvas元素,用于绘制热力图。通过canvas的API和第三方库提供的方法,可以实现对地图的绘制和渲染。在绘制时,需要将准备好的地理信息数据传入热力图库,并根据数据的分布密度绘制热力图效果。

    步骤四:交互及功能优化

    为了提升用户体验,可以添加一些交互功能,例如缩放、拖动地图等操作。这些功能可以通过监听用户的手势事件来实现。同时,可以根据实际需求对热力图的显示效果进行调整,例如调整颜色映射、密度计算等参数。

    步骤五:实时更新

    如果需要实时展示用户位置信息以及热力图效果,可以通过定时更新数据并重新绘制地图来实现。可以结合小程序的生命周期函数和定时器功能,实现数据的实时更新和热力图的动态展示。

    通过以上步骤,可以成功加载微信热力图并展示用户分布密度等信息。在实际开发中,还可以根据具体需求对热力图进行定制化设计,使其更符合产品需求和用户体验。

    3个月前 0条评论
站长微信
站长微信
分享本页
返回顶部